Income Sources And Wealth Building In Japan

Understanding income sources is fundamental to analyzing nippon net worth japan. Regular wages, side jobs, and portfolio income interact with public benefits and corporate bonuses to shape household cash flow.

Wealth building depends on consistent saving, diversified assets, and access to employer sponsored retirement plans. Employees who combine stable base pay with performance bonuses and prudent investing can steadily grow personal and family net worth over time.

Regional Cost Of Living And Asset Prices

Housing markets and daily expenses vary significantly between Tokyo, Osaka, and rural prefectures, directly affecting disposable income and nippon net worth japan. Urban centers typically show higher nominal incomes but also elevated rent and property prices.

Regional policies on public transport, childcare support, and small business incentives influence how far household budgets stretch. Savvy financial planning takes local cost structures into account when setting savings and investment targets.

Policy Environment And Economic Outlook

Monetary easing, corporate governance reforms, and tax adjustments shape the broader environment for nippon net worth japan. Government initiatives aimed at wage growth and regional revitalization can boost household resilience.

Demographic changes, productivity trends, and global market conditions introduce uncertainty. Adaptive financial strategies, including diversified income streams and contingency reserves, prepare individuals for shifting economic conditions.
